The Fuel Pick Up Line with Filter is an OEM plastic part used to filter and deliver fuel to the carburetor. If broken, the engine will not get fuel and the part should be replaced. This part is rated "Easy" to install and only requires a set of pliers.
This Spark Plug is inserted into the cylinder head and is rated as "Easy" to install. The spark plug ignites the air fuel mixture inside the combustion chamber. If the part doesn't work, or is missing then the engine will not start and the spark plug must be replaced. This part should also be replaced annually as a part of proper engine maintenance. Tip: Gap to manufacturer's specs before installing.
The impeller blade goes between the upper impeller housing and the lower impeller housing. This part is sold individually and is made of plastic. This is an OEM item sourced directly from the manufacturer and used in blowers made by Ryobi, Troy-Bilt, Yard Man, MTD, and Cub Cadet. You may need a screwdriver, a socket set, and a set of pliers when replacing this part. It may become broken and will need to be replaced.
